Product Main Parameters
| Item | Data |
|---|---|
| Voltage | 110v/220v |
| Frequency | 50/60HZ |
| Input Power | 50W |
| Max. Output Current | 100ua |
| Output Power Voltage | 0-100kv |
| Input Air Pressure | 0.3-0.6Mpa |
| Powder Consumption | Max 550g/min |
| Polarity | Negative |
| Gun Weight | 480g |
| Length of Gun Cable | 5m |

Product Manufacturing Process
The manufacturing process of our powder coating system is meticulously designed to ensure high-quality finished products. Initially, raw materials, including pigments and resins, are blended to create a fine powder. Then, this powder is electrostatically charged and sprayed onto the metal surfaces using a high-precision spray gun. Following application, the coated items are cured in an oven at high temperatures ranging from 160 to 210 degrees Celsius. This process ensures the coating adheres firmly, offering enhanced durability and resistance. Product Application Scenarios
Powder coating systems are extensively used in multiple industries due to their durability and environmental benefits. In the automotive sector, components such as wheels and bumpers are powder coated to provide resistance against harsh elements and enhance aesthetic appeal. Consumer goods, including appliances and outdoor furniture, benefit from powder coating for their long-lasting finish. Architectural applications involve coating aluminum extrusions for enhanced weather resistance. Industrial equipment also relies on powder coating for a robust protective layer, ensuring machinery and tools withstand wear and tear. - Understanding the Economics of Powder Coating Systems
The economic advantages of powder coating systems are significant, especially from a manufacturer's perspective. While the initial investment may seem high, the savings in material costs and increased production efficiency result in long-term benefits. Powder coating systems utilize nearly 100% of the powder, thanks to the recyclable overspray, which contrasts sharply with the wastage seen in conventional painting methods. The reduced curing time further speeds up production, enhancing throughput. These factors contribute to a more sustainable and profitable operation, solidifying the system's role in modern manufacturing.
